The Inside was a police procedural television series that aired on Fox in the summer of 2005. Thirteen episodes were produced but only seven were shown in America; the remaining episodes aired a year later in Britain. The show, created by Tim Minear and Howard Gordon, chronicled the work of an elite FBI unit devoted to tracking down serial killers and other violent criminals. The show starred Peter Coyote as Virgil "Web" Webster, the ruthless and manipulative team leader; Rachel Nichols as Rebecca Locke, a brilliant rookie profiler with a mysterious traumatic past; and Jay Harrington as Paul Ryan, an investigator deeply disturbed by Web's methods. These three characters were at the heart of the series; additionally (though not included in this vid), the show featured Adam Baldwin (Firefly) and Nelsan Ellis (True Blood) as other members of the unit, and guest-starred Amber Benson, Michael Emerson, Chad Lindberg, Keith Szarabajka, and Zeljko Ivanek.
